Abstract

1437372 Casting processes W H MOORE 30 April 1973 [1 Nov 1972] 20345/73 Heading B3F [Also in Division C7] Low sulphur iron having a chill value of not more than <SP>8</SP>/ 32 inch is initially treated with sufficient rare earth metal and alkaline earth metal to increase the chill value by 50 to 150% and is then poured into a mould incorporating a reservoir and skimmer gate, the reservoir containing “-1“% (based on the wt. of iron) of a magnesium alloy such that the iron has a residual magnesium content of at least 0À1%. The iron may contain (by wt.) 3À3-4% C, 1-3% Si, 0À2-1% Mn, 0À02-0À1% P, 0À005-0À06% S, with possibly also Ni, Cu and/or Mo, the low sulphur content being obtained by treatment with calcium carbide while agitating the bath by gas from a porous plug; the preferred addition agent for the first step of the spheroidizing process is a mixture of cerium fluoride with calcium silicide or carbide. The magnesium additive may be in the form of magnesium ferrosilicon or magnesium-nickel alloy and may initially occupy between 25 and 50% of the volume of the reservoir.
